Kanturk delivered a stunning statement of intent in their Cork Premier Senior Hurling Championship campaign, overturning a five-point half-time deficit to secure a commanding 13-point victory over Fr O’Neill’s. According to local match reports on Echo Live, the dramatic turnaround showcased elite tactical resilience and high-intensity second-half execution.

Tactical Adjustments and the Second-Half Surge
Trailing by five points at the interval, Kanturk faced a defining tactical crossroad. The tape from the opening period showed Fr O’Neill’s successfully disrupting Kanturk’s build-up phase, clogging the central corridors and restricting clean supply into the inside forward line. But the tactical whiteboard told a different story after the restart. Kanturk’s management reshaped their half-forward line deployment, injecting greater pace and off-the-ball movement to puncture the Fr O’Neill’s defensive structure.
By increasing their work rate in the middle third, Kanturk completely shifted the expected scores (xG equivalents in hurling) in their favor. They converted turnovers into rapid, transition-based scores before the opposition defense could reset. The physical dominance in the middle-eight battlegrounds drained Fr O’Neill’s stamina, opening up expansive gaps in the final quarter.
